Water hammer noise in Plumbing systems is commonly caused by sudden changes in water flow, such as when a valve is closed quickly. This can create a shockwave that results in the banging sound. To solve this issue, installing water hammer arrestors, adjusting water pressure, securing loose pipes, and ensuring proper air chambers in the system can help reduce or eliminate the noise.
